首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在drupal页面中包含JS

在Drupal页面中包含JS是指在Drupal网站的页面中引入JavaScript代码,以实现各种交互和动态效果。以下是关于在Drupal页面中包含JS的一些详细信息:

概念:

在Drupal中,可以通过在主题文件或模块文件中添加代码来包含JavaScript。这些JavaScript代码可以用于改变页面元素、处理表单提交、实现动画效果等。

分类:

在Drupal中,包含JS的方式可以分为两种:内联和外部引用。

  1. 内联:将JavaScript代码直接嵌入到HTML页面中,可以在主题文件的模板文件中使用<script>标签来实现。
  2. 外部引用:将JavaScript代码保存在外部文件中,并通过<script>标签引用该文件。可以将外部JavaScript文件放置在主题文件夹或自定义模块文件夹中。

优势:

  • 可维护性:将JavaScript代码与HTML分离,使得代码更易于维护和管理。
  • 可重用性:可以在多个页面中共享和重用JavaScript代码。
  • 可扩展性:通过使用Drupal的钩子和模块化开发,可以轻松地扩展和定制JavaScript功能。

应用场景:

  • 表单验证:使用JavaScript可以在客户端对表单进行验证,提高用户体验。
  • 动态加载内容:通过使用AJAX技术,可以实现在不刷新整个页面的情况下动态加载内容。
  • 页面交互效果:使用JavaScript可以实现各种页面交互效果,如轮播图、下拉菜单等。
  • 第三方集成:通过引入第三方JavaScript库,可以实现与其他服务或功能的集成,如地图、社交媒体分享等。

推荐的腾讯云相关产品和产品介绍链接地址:

以上是关于在Drupal页面中包含JS的概念、分类、优势、应用场景以及推荐的腾讯云相关产品和产品介绍链接地址的完善答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JS页面跳转,传值包含中文时乱码解决方案

转自:http://blog.csdn.net/southcamel/article/details/7703317 首先,JS中将要传递的中文编码:encodeURI(encodeURI(value...)); 然后跳转界面取值时通过以下方式解码:java.net.URLDecoder.decode(value , "UTF-8");//如果界面都是用UTF-8格式编码的话。...注意: 对于URL传递的数据和表单GET方式提交的数据,接收页面通过设置request.setCharacterEncoding("UTF-8")来解决乱码问题是不行的,因为...request.setCharacterEncoding 参数对URL提交的数据和表单GET方式提交的数据进行重新编码,默认情况下,该参数为false(Tomcat4.0该参数默认为true);...所以对于URL提交的数据和表单GET方式提交的数据,可以修改 URIEncoding参数为浏览器编码或者修改useBodyEncodingForURI为true,并且获得数据的JSP页面 request.setCharacterEncoding

4K20

drupal linux安装,Debian 10(Buster) Linux服务器安装drupal 8.8.0的说明

按照本说明,你就可以成功的Debian 10(Buster) Linux服务器安装好drupal 8.8.0版本,已亲测能稳定运行。...先决条件 开始安装之前,对安装的最低要求是: 数据库服务器,如MySQL、MariaDB、PostgreSQL、Percona、SQLite等。 Web服务器,如Nginx、Apache。...mv drupal-8.8.0 /var/www/html/drupal 设置目录权限: sudo chown -R www-data:www-data /var/www/html/drupal 然后...Debian 10Drupal 8.8.0创建Apache配置文件: sudo nano /etc/apache2/sites-available/drupal.conf 基本配置如下,请替换成自己的数据...8/RHEL 8上安装和配置Drupal 8的方法”,在上面已给出了链接,浏览器运行 http://example.com(以上配置的网站域) 就可以进行配置安装了,需要填写的信息相当的简单,请根据自己的信息填写即可

1.3K20

js判断数组是否包含某个指定元素的个数_js 数组包含某个元素

,"Banana","Orange","Apple"]; var a = fruits.indexOf("Apple",4); // 6 注:string.indexOf()返回某个指定的字符串值字符串首次出现的位置...开始检索的位置字符串的 fromindex 处或字符串的开头(没有指定 fromindex 时)。如果找到一个 searchvalue,则返回 searchvalue 的第一次出现的位置。...find() 方法为数组的每个元素都调用一次函数执行: 当数组的元素测试条件时返回 true 时, find() 返回符合条件的元素,之后的值不会再调用执行函数。...findIndex() 方法为数组的每个元素都调用一次函数执行: 当数组的元素测试条件时返回 true 时, findIndex() 返回符合条件的元素的索引位置,之后的值不会再调用执行函数。...== 查找值) { //则包含该元素 } }) 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。

11.1K30

JS跳转代码_js跳转页面路径

一、常规的JS页面跳转代码 1、原来的窗体中直接跳转用 2、新窗体打开页面用: 3、JS页面跳转参数的注解 参数解释: 第2种: 第3种: 第4种: 第5种: 三、页面停留指定时间再跳转(如3秒)...四、根据访客来源跳转的JS代码 1、JS判断来路代码 此段代码主要用于百度谷歌点击进入跳转,直接打开网站不跳转: 2、JS直接跳转代码 3、ASP跳转代码判断来路 <%   if instr(Request.ServerVariables...www.at8k.com/”)   end if   %> 4、ASP直接跳转的 <%   response.redirect(“http://www.at8k.com/”)   %> 五、广告与网站页面一起的...JS代码 1、上面是广告下面是站群的代码 document.writeln(“”); 2、全部覆盖的代码 document.write(“”); 3、混淆防止搜索引擎被查的js调用 具体的展示上面是广告下面是站群的代码...document.body.children[i].style.display=“non”+“e”; //} } }catch(e){}    }    },100);   }catch(e){} 六、页面跳出框架

16.9K30

js判断数组是否包含某元素的方法有哪些_js判断数组里面是否包含某个元素

Banana","Orange","Apple"]; var a = fruits.indexOf("Apple",4); // 6 1 2 注:string.indexOf()返回某个指定的字符串值字符串首次出现的位置...find() 方法为数组的每个元素都调用一次函数执行: 当数组的元素测试条件时返回 true 时, find() 返回符合条件的元素,之后的值不会再调用执行函数。...findIndex() 方法为数组的每个元素都调用一次函数执行: 当数组的元素测试条件时返回 true 时, findIndex() 返回符合条件的元素的索引位置,之后的值不会再调用执行函数。...(v=>{ if(v === 查找值) { //则包含该元素 } }) 别的做法: js存在一个数组,如何判断一个元素是否存在于这个数组呢,首先是通过循环的办法判断,...,不然是会报错的,另外,该方法某些版本的IE是不起作用的,因此使用之前需要做一下判断,修改后的代码如下所示: /** * 使用indexOf判断元素是否存在于数组 * @param {Object

9.9K60

如何在页面引入JS教程

1.直接写到页面 须位于 与 标签之间,放置 HTML 页面的 或者 标签: <script type="text/javascript...,默认是text/javascript src : 表示<em>包含</em>要执行代码的外部文件 注意:<em>js</em>代码所写的位置会影响到代码的执行效果 2.写到标签元素的事件属性里面 3.写到一个外部的文件里面(.<em>js</em>结尾的文件) 写到一个<em>js</em>文件<em>中</em>,然后哪个<em>页面</em>使用就引入过来,类似于css样式表的引用...例如: 【注意事项】 1.不要在标签<em>中</em>再填写其他...<em>js</em>代码,否则将会忽略 2.标签位置标签<em>中</em>:等到全部的<em>js</em>代码都被下载,解释和执行完成后才能开始呈现<em>页面</em>的内容。

5.4K20

js控制台打印html页面,vue 使用print-js 打印html页面

Print.js 官网 官网 优点:可以打印多种格式的内容(pdf、json、html等) 打印json时可以添加表头。...打印html页时可以继承原有页面的样式,局部打印,过滤掉要打印的元素,及其方便。...一、vue安装命令: npm install print-js –save 二、引入 这个引入不需要在main.js,直接在使用的.vue引入即可 这里颜色虽然是灰色,但是也要添加,否则会报错。...三、编码 我这里要打印 html 的div ,调用函数找到 div 的 id。...targetStyles: [’*’],这样设置继承了页面要打印元素原有的css属性。 style:传入自定义样式的字符串,使用在要打印的html页面 也就是纸上的样子。

8.5K30

Java如何高效判断数组是否包含某个元素

这是一个Java中经常用到的并且非常有用的操作。同时,这个问题在Stack Overflow也是一个非常热门的问题。...投票比较高的几个答案给出了几种不同的方法,但是他们的时间复杂度也是各不相同的。本文将分析几种常见用法及其时间成本。...查找有序数组是否包含某个值的用法如下: public static boolean useArraysBinarySearch(String[] arr, String targetValue) {...实际上,如果你需要借助数组或者集合类高效地检查数组是否包含特定值,一个已排序的列表或树可以做到时间复杂度为O(log(n)),hashset可以达到O(1)。...35183useLoop: 3218useArrayBinary: 14useArrayUtils: 3125 其实,如果查看ArrayUtils.contains的源码可以发现,他判断一个元素是否包含在数组其实也是使用循环判断的方式

5.2K10
领券